SH1211 MouseCoder® Ergonomic Mouse PS/2 and RS232 Encoder
HID & SYSTEM MANAGEMENT PRODUCTS, MOUSECODER® FAMILY DESCRIPTION The SH1211 MouseCoder® is an easy-to-use single-chip multimouse encoder with an advanced motion algorithm for accurate cursor control. The SH1211 offers low power consumption in a smallfootprint package, and connects to a host serial or a PS/2 mouse port. The SH1211 is designed for use with a Fujitsu Takamisawa FID-828 Hall-effect sensor (HulaPointTM), a resistive analog joystick sensor (like the CTS 252), a switch joystick sensor, an FSR sensor, or a Varatouch MicroPointTM sensor, as well as others. The SH1211 provides an external port for hot-plug connection of a PS/2 mouse, including one with wheel function. SH1211 serial communication is unidirectional at a fixed speed of 1200 Baud. PS/2 communication is bidirectional at 10 Kbps. The SH1211 is a CMOS device operating at 4 MHz. It can return mouse reports at the rate of 100 per second. The SH1211 is compatible with the standard twobutton mouse protocol, the standard three-button mouse protocol, and standard wheel mouse protocols. It implements all commands from and to the system, as defined in the IBM PS/2 mouse communication protocol. The SH1211's low power consumption makes it ideal for battery operated systems. FEATURES · Advanced motion-control algorithm for accurate cursor control · Low power consumption in a 3.3 to 5.5 volt operating range · Compatible with standard twobutton, three-button, and wheel mice · RS232 or PS/2 host interface · Works with a Hall-effect sensor · Works with a resistive analog joystick sensor · Works with a switch joystick sensor · Works with an FSR sensor · Works with a Varatouch MicroPointTM sensor · Available in a small 32-pin plastic LQFP package

FUNCTIONAL DESCRIPTION The SH1211 consists functionally of five major sections (see block diagram below). These are the Sensor Interface, the 16-bit Timer, the Oscillator Circuit, the PS/2 Communication Port and the RS232 Communication Port. All sections communicate with each other and operate concurrently. BLOCK DIAGRAM

MOUSE EMULATION The SH1211 emulates either a standard 3-button mouse or a standard wheel mouse. The state of the button configuration pin (BCONF, pin 20) determines which mouse type is emulated. The pin left floating specifies 3-button mode, the pin tied to ground specifies wheel mode. In 3-button mode, the left, right and middle buttons are implemented. In wheel mode, the left, right, up, and down buttons are implemented; pressing up and down buttons together emulates a middle-button press. POWER CONSUMPTION The SH1211 typically consumes less than 3 mA in standby for HulaPointTM or analog joystick sensors and less than 1 µA for other sensors. EXTERNAL PS/2 PORT The SH1211 provides an external PS/2 mouse port. Data from this port is seamlessly merged with data from the embedded sensor. External mice, including those with a mouse wheel, can be hot-plug connected. HOST INTERFACE The SH1211 communicates with the host system using either PS/2 or serial. The state of the interface select pin (INTSEL, pin 26) determines which interface is used. If the pin is tied to ground, PS/2 is used; if it is tied to power (Vcc), serial is used.
SENSOR CONFIGURATIONS The SH1211 has built-in support applicable to many sensors, including the following: HulaPointTM Fujitsu Takamisawa FID-828 Hall-effect sensor Analog joystick sensor such as the CTS 252 Switch joystick sensor FSRTM sensor (Force Sensing ResistorTM, Interlink Electronics) Varatouch MicroPointTM sensor
The states of the sensor select pins 18 and 21 (SENSEL1, SENSEL2) indicate which sensor is being used. The name, definition and use of the 16 sensor pins (SEN00-SEN15: pins 14, 29-32, 15, 16, 20, 22-25) vary depending on which sensor is being used. Refer to the schematics and pin definitions in this data sheet for specifics.
